Can the dental implant fall out?
It is rare that your dental implant will fall out. During the recovery phase, your bone should connect with the implant to lock it with the jaw. Some people confuse the crown with their implant falling out that is not the same thing. Contact us if you have any problems or concerns.
Can teeth whitening damage my teeth?
The British Dental Association (BDA) says whitening is perfectly safe if carried out by a registered dental professional. During your consultation, our team will discuss your oral health because with sensitive teeth and gums, this treatment can increase sensitivity. Book in your consultation today.
